Diagnosis

Adult ADHD is a condition that can assist you if you feel like your relationships, work, or school are falling apart. While it may seem like a big deal, it can also be something that helps you take control of your life and receive the assistance you need.

A doctor can diagnose ADHD in a patient's medical and mental health history. The present symptoms must be taken into consideration. The doctor will also be able to assess the patient's capacity for normal functioning in various spheres including at home, at school, at work, and social interactions.

The clinician will utilize the symptoms described in the Diagnostic and Statistical Manual of Mental Disorders, Fifth Edition (DSM-5), to determine the patient's condition. This includes hyperactivity, inattention and inattention.

Additionally, adhd test for adults free must have had at the very least one of these symptoms before age 12. They have to have caused problems in multiple areas.

Many adults have difficulty remembering their childhood symptoms. This is why it is important to speak with a doctor who knows their family history. This could be parents, siblings, or close friends.

It is crucial that the patient be honest about their symptoms and how they affect their daily lives. If you're not honest with your doctor, they may not be able to accurately assess your symptoms and come up with an accurate diagnosis.

As part of the test the professional will ask you to complete an assessment questionnaire dubbed the ASRS-v1.1. It will ask you to describe your symptoms, how they impact your life, and what treatments you have tried so far.

If a specialist believes you're likely to have adult ADHD They may suggest further tests. The tests could include an online task that measures the level of focus and control of impulses. They may also try to figure out whether you are suffering from other disorders that could be contributing to your symptoms, for example, anxiety or depression.

A doctor will also conduct a detailed interview with you to discover more about your symptoms and how they affect your life. They will also review your school records and talk to people who knew you as a child like your teachers and parents.

Treatment

If you've been diagnosed with ADHD, the first thing you must do is talk to your doctor about the treatment options. There are a variety of effective medications and behavioral therapies that can help manage your symptoms.

It is possible to test various combinations of medicines based on your age before you discover the best one. You will also need to change your lifestyle and habits in order to reap the benefits of these treatments.

Your doctor can assist you to find a reliable ADHD specialist. They will ask you about any symptoms you have and problems they've caused, such as problems at work, school or in relationships.

Your doctor will also conduct various tests to evaluate you and your symptoms, such as symptoms checklists as well as attention-span tests. These tests are designed to determine how you react to stimuli, and they examine your results against those of others who have typical attention responses.

In addition the doctor will conduct a thorough medical history, including any problems you've faced at home or work, as well as alcohol and drug use, and relationships with family members and friends. If you require a comprehensive psychiatric exam your doctor might refer you to a psychiatrist or psychologist.

Once you've been diagnosed with ADHD Once you have been diagnosed, you can begin treatment with a psychiatrist and psychologist. These professionals in mental health can prescribe medication and conduct treatments that can aid in managing your symptoms enhance your quality of life, and lessen the negative effects of ADHD on your life.

You can also try a variety of calming therapies, like yoga and meditation. These treatments can help enhance your focus, decrease the amount of impulsivity you exhibit, and decrease anxiety.

A few people benefit from cognitive behavior therapy, which can help you develop the skills to manage ADHD and improve overall life quality. Additionally therapy for families and marriage can assist you and your spouse or partner improve communication, problems-solving and conflict resolution skills.
